Slump? What slump? Cristiano Ronaldo racks up yet more records

Cristiano Ronaldo struck the quickest hat-trick of his career on his way to netting five goals in Real Madrid's 9-1 drubbing of second-from-bottom Granada on Sunday which took Real to within a point of La Liga leaders Barcelona.

Portugal forward Ronaldo struck three times in eight minutes after Gareth Bale had fired Real ahead in the 25th minute on a festive, sun-drenched afternoon at the Bernabeu.

Ronaldo has scored three or more goals 24 times in La Liga, equalling the record set this season by his great rival, Barcelona forward Lionel Messi.


World player of the year Ronaldo has 31 career hat-tricks overall but Sunday's effort was only the second time he has scored one in the first half.

However, 28 of those hat-tricks have come in Real Madrid colours, which puts him level with one Alfredo Di Stefano.


His haul of five goals also put him in esteemed company.
